LA men allegedly ‘hunted’ casino winners, robbed them at gunpoint

Two South Gate men, Juan Gabriel Gonzalez, 22, and Dereck Nathan Lopez, 21, are facing federal charges for allegedly stalking and robbing over a dozen casino winners at gunpoint on highways.

Prosecutors say the pair used fake names in casinos to target big winners, then followed and ambushed them, stealing cash or chips in at least 15 incidents.

One victim lost $21,000; another lost $130,000. Lopez, a convicted felon, also faces weapons charges, KTLA 5 has reported.

If convicted, both men could face life in prison.
